DAY 6 - MENARI TO NAURO - WEDNESDAY 18 JUNE

Only a half day of trekking today however, it was still a tough one! The trekkers made their way out of Menari for 20 minutes before crossing a small bridge and another 30 mins hike to a rest break. Then it was their first accent of the day up-to the Menari lookout where they could see the village in the distance they camped at last night. Then they trekked down the ridge for 45 minutes and refilled their water before they crossed a very, very muddy swamp with dilapidated bridges on the way to Brown River for a refreshing swim. Then they trekked a short 15 minutes to Amaduri village for morning tea and then back into the swamp for 45 minutes in the increasing humidity to the base of the false peaks. It was a hot, hot day som they then enjoyed a rest at the base of the peaks before continuing up the seemingly never-ending slopes of the Maguli Range to today’s camp at new Nauro Village. The trekkers arrived in camp early at 1:30pm and are now enjoying an early end to the day, doing some washing and as always a few men having an afternoon nap.
